MEMO — Kettling Depot Receiving

Uniform sets for the new Kettling depot arrive Wednesday via Ashgrove courier: 40 boxes, sorted by size, manifest attached to box one. Check the count at the dock before signing; shortages go straight to stores, not the courier. The hand-over instruction the courier will follow is set out below.

drop instructions, tafof-baguf: the holmir gilox courier leaves the sormir ulaok holdor ledger at gate 5596 under passcode 257343

## Further reading

The Ferngate rules engine evaluates shipping-fee rules in priority order: carrier surcharges first, then regional adjustments, then promotional overrides. Rules are authored in the Ferngate DSL and deployed through the standard pipeline; there is no runtime editing in production. New team members should review the rule lifecycle, the test harness, and the priority-resolution examples before writing their first rule. All of that material is collected on the internal page below.

wiki page, hahif-hahif: https://argocd.kelvisys.corp/browse/board/settings/pages/1442e0b1065d83f1

**Vendor note: Inkmill markdown pipeline**

Rendering for Parchway docs is outsourced to Inkmill under an annual contract, renewing each March. They handle sanitization and PDF export; we own the upload queue. SLA: 4-hour response on rendering failures. Escalate only after two failed retries. Their support desk is reachable at the address below.

billing contact of hahaf-baguf = zorael.tammir.jorius@sivrelhq.internal